Ethena Labs Expands Collateral for USDe Adding BNB, XRP

Ethena Labs announced the inclusion of BNB, XRP, and HYPE in USDe’s collateral framework on August 22, 2025, aiming for a $20 billion supply target.
The move highlights Ethena’s strategic approach to stabilize USDe’s growth through rigorous risk management and expanding crypto market influence.
Introduction
Ethena Labs has expanded its USDe collateral framework by including BNB, XRP, and HYPE. This move aligns with their strategy to increase supply to $20 billion, subject to favorable macroeconomic conditions.
The inclusion of BNB, XRP, and HYPE was confirmed by Ethena Labs’ official Twitter. They stated, “As part of the new framework, BNB has been approved as collateral; XRP and HYPE also meet the established criteria for support in the near future.” This action entails rigorous risk management protocols and meets institutional liquidity standards.
